Entwistle Green are delighted to market this fabulous family home in the heart of Helmshore situated in a quiet cul-de-sac. The property comprises: entrance hallway leading to open planned lounge-dining room, fitted kitchen and conservatory to rear overlooking enclosed garden. To first floor, three bedrooms and family bathroom suite. To front of the property is driveway leading to side.

3 Bedrooms
Lounge
Dining Room
Kitchen
Conservatory
Bathroom
OUTSIDE


GROUND FLOOR

Entrance Hall    One radiator, one double glazed window and one ceiling light point.

Lounge 13' x 13'3" (3.96m x 4.04m). Well presented lounge with laminate flooring, gas living flame effect stone feature surround fire place, two double glazed windows, two radiators, under stairs storage and open through to:

Dining Room 9'6" x 7'11" (2.9m x 2.41m). Open through from lounge, sliding doors to conservatory, door to kitchen, one ceiling light point and one radiator.

Kitchen 9'7" x 8' (2.92m x 2.44m). Recently fitted kitchen (September 2013 comprising a range of stylish contemporary wall land base units with down lights, double electric oven and gas hob, stainless steel sink and drainer, integrated dishwasher, integrated fridge, integrated freezer, space for utilities, built into unit boiler, splash wall tiling, laminate flooring, one double glazed window, one ceiling light point and one radiator.

Conservatory 11'1" x 7'8" (3.38m x 2.34m). Spacious conservatory leading from dining room with suspended ceiling with spotlighting, double doors leading to garden and fitted blinds. Radiator.

FIRST FLOOR

Landing    One frosted double glazed window, one ceiling light point and storage.

Bedroom One 9'2" x 11'3" (2.8m x 3.43m). One double glazed window, one ceiling light point and one radiator.

Bedroom Two 8'1" (2.46m). One double glazed window, one ceiling light point and one radiator.

Bedroom Three 8' x 7'3" (2.44m x 2.2m). One leaded double glazed window, fitted wardrobes, one ceiling light point, one radiator and access to loft.

Bathroom    Bath with shower over, hand basin, WC, one frosted double glazed window, vinyl flooring, extractor, splash wall tiling and one radiator.

OUTSIDE    The property is garden fronted with good sized driveway providing parking for approximately three vehicles. To the rear garden is not overlooked and has the benefit of open views with a flagged patio and laid to lawn gardens with a pathway leading to a shed. Fenced perimeters.

NB    The property has recently had carpets fitted in some rooms. The loft is partially boarded.
